Comprehending Skin Pigmentation
Skin pigmentation disorders happen when the body produces either excessive or too little melanin, the pigment that offers skin its color. Factors such as sun exposure, hormone changes, and aging can cause coloring problems. These conditions can manifest as irregular complexion, dark areas, or basic discoloration, impacting one's appearance and, subsequently, confidence.

The Future of Laser Acne Treatment: Developments and Emerging Technologies
Laser acne treatment has actually become a powerful tool in the battle versus acne, providing a non-invasive and effective service for both active acne and acne scars. Nevertheless, current laser innovations have restrictions, such as the danger of negative effects, limited efficiency for certain skin types, and the requirement for multiple treatment sessions.
Thankfully, the future of laser acne treatment is intense, with numerous innovative technologies and emerging developments poised to reinvent this field. Let's explore how these innovations will shape the future of acne management and enhance the treatment experience for patients.
FREQUENTLY ASKED QUESTION:
Q: What are the advantages of AI-powered laser treatment for acne? A: AI-powered laser treatment for acne uses a number of benefits, including:
• Increased precision and precision: AI algorithms can analyze specific skin characteristics and tailor laser treatments to optimize their efficiency and minimize side effects.
• Customized treatment strategies: AI can assist customize treatment strategies based on individual needs and skin type.
• Reduced risk of side effects: By targeting specific areas with the suitable laser specifications, AI can help reduce the risk of side effects such as scarring and hyperpigmentation.
• Improved treatment outcomes: AI can help anticipate the possible response to treatment, permitting changes to be made as needed to enhance results.
Q: What are the advantages of robotic laser systems for dealing with acne? A: Robotic laser systems offer a number of advantages over conventional hand-held lasers, including:
• Increased consistency and accuracy: Robotic arms eliminate the risk of human mistake, ensuring consistent and exact delivery of laser energy.
• Decreased treatment time: Robotic systems can carry out laser treatments quicker than hand-held lasers, resulting in shorter treatment sessions.
• Improved security: Robotic arms can be programmed to avoid sensitive areas of the skin, lessening the risk of adverse effects.
Q: How do novel laser technologies, such as fractional lasers and picosecond lasers, work for dealing with acne? A:
• Fractional lasers: These lasers produce tiny columns of ablated tissue within the skin, promoting collagen production and skin resurfacing. This can be especially helpful for treating acne scars and hyperpigmentation.
• Picosecond lasers: These lasers provide picosecond-duration pulses of light, permitting more targeted treatment of melanin-rich acne sores and minimizing the threat of adverse effects.
